Bank of America to Reduce Overdraft Fees

Bank of America announced significant changes to its overdraft services, including plans to eliminate non-sufficient funds (NSF) fees beginning in February, and to reduce overdraft fees from $35 to $10 beginning in May. New Mobileye Chip to Allow for Autonomous Driving

Mobileye has introduced the EyeQ Ultra at CES in Las Vegas, the company’s most advanced, highest performing system-on-chip (SoC) purpose-built for autonomous driving. EyeQ Ultra maximizes both effectiveness and efficiency at only 176 TOPS, making it the industry’s leanest autonomous vehicle (AV) chip. Walmart Wants to Deliver Directly to Your Fridge

Walmart wants to soon deliver groceries not just to your front door, but directly in your refrigerator. The nation’s largest retailer is expanding its InHome delivery service, from 6 million households to 30 million U.S. households by the end of the year.
